Pedro de Alvarado y Contreras (also known as Don Pedro de Alvarado) (c.1495-1541) was a Spanish conquistador, known for his skill as a soldier and cruelty to native populations. He was left in command of the Spanish force in Tenochtitlan. Date created early 17th century. The Conquistadors by Hammond Innes, page 160.
